Analysis
The most recent figure for indonesia — newsprint — export quantity in Canada is 103 t, measured in 2016.
That represents a change of down 58.8% on the previous year and up 151.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, indonesia — newsprint — export quantity in Canada peaked at 13,824 t in 1997 and was at its lowest, 41 t, in 2006.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
